IEG Drives Green Skills Agenda at CPCA Regional Careers Conference

Inspire Education Group (IEG) was proud to contribute to the Cambridgeshire & Peterborough Careers Hub Conference on 2nd July, where education, business and local leaders came together to explore how best to prepare young people to develop green skills for the future world of work.

As a key contributor, IEG supported a workshop focused on integrating green skills into careers education, sharing best practices with secondary and special educational needs (SEND) schools, employers and key regional stakeholders.

The session also provided an opportunity to highlight IEG’s flagship investment in sustainability education: the new Centre for Green Technology at Peterborough College. Set to welcome students later this year, the Centre is a £13.5 million facility that will deliver cutting-edge training in retrofit, electric vehicle systems, low-carbon construction and alternative heat technologies — supporting the region’s transition to net zero.
